Inclusion criteria

Inclusion criteria: - Male or female Japanese patients 20 years of age or older on the day of consent. - Documented histological or cytological diagnosis of RCC with a clear-cell component. - Measurable disease per response evaluation criteria in solid tumors version 1.1 (RECIST V 1.1) as determined by the investigator. - Must have received at least one VEGFR-targeting TKI (eg, sorafenib, sunitinib, axitinib, pazopanib or tivozanib). - For the most recently received VEGFR-targeting TKI the following criteria must apply: 1. Must have radiographically progressed during treatment, or been treated for at least 4 weeks and radiographically progressed within 6 months after the last dose. Radiographic progression is defined as unequivocal progression of existing tumor lesions or developing new tumor lesions as assessed by the investigator on computerized tomography (CT) or magnetic resonance imaging (MRI) scans. 2. The last dose must have been within 6 months before the first day of study drug administration (Week 1 Day 1). - Recovery to baseline or =- Karnofsky Performance Status (KPS) score of >=70%. - Adequate organ and marrow function at Screening.

Exclusion criteria

Exclusion criteria: - Prior treatment with everolimus, or any other specific or selective target of rapamycin complex 1 /phosphoinositide 3-kinase/AKT inhibitor (eg, temsirolimus), or cabozantinib. - Receipt of any type of small-molecule kinase inhibitor (including investigational kinase inhibitor) within 14 days before Week 1 Day 1. - Receipt of any type of anticancer antibody (including investigational antibody) within 28 days before Week 1 Day 1. - Radiation therapy for bone metastasis within 14 days, and/or any other external radiation therapy within 28 days before Week 1 Day 1. Systemic treatment with radionuclides within 42 days before Week 1 Day 1. Patients with clinically relevant ongoing complications from prior radiation therapy are not eligible.

Design outcomes

Primary

MeasureTime frame
efficacy Objective Response Rate (ORR) Timeframe; From first dose of study drug up to disease progression or death (up to 2.5 years) ORR was defined as the percentage of participants whose best overall response was complete response rate (CR) or partial response (PR) evaluated by independent review committee (IRC) per RECIST V1.1 which was confirmed by a subsequent evaluation conducted >=28 days later. Per RECIST V1.1, CR was defined as the disappearance of all lesions, and all pathological lymph nodes (whether target or nontarget) must have a reduction in short axis to <10 millimeter (mm). PR was defined as at least a 30% decrease in the sum of diameter (SoD) of target lesions, taking as a reference the Baseline SoD.

Secondary

MeasureTime frame
efficacy Clinical Benefit Rate (CBR) Timeframe; From first dose of study drug up to disease progression or death (up to 2.5 years) CBR was defined as participants whose best overall response is CR, PR or stable disease (SD) per RECIST 1.1. Response and progression is evaluated by IRC per RECIST V1.1. CR and PR required confirmation by a subsequent evaluation conducted >=28 days later and an assessment of SD was made at least 8 weeks after the first day of study drug. Per RECIST V1.1, CR was defined as the disappearance of all lesions, and all pathological lymph nodes (whether target or nontarget) must have a reduction in the short axis to <10 mm. PR was defined as at least a 30% decrease in SoD of target lesions, taking as a reference the Baseline SoD. SD was defined as neither sufficient shrinkage to qualify for PR nor sufficient increase to qualify for progressive disease (PD). efficacy Progression-Free Survival (PFS) Timeframe; From first dose of study drug up to disease progression or death (up to 2.5 years) PFS was defined as time from the first day of study drug administration to the earlier of PD, per RECIST 1.1 or death due to any cause. Per RECIST V1.1, PD was defined at least a 20% increase in the SoD of target lesions, taking as a reference the smallest (nadir) SoD since (and including) Baseline.
